So now that I've finally got my state medical license, do I have to start earning CME credits? Where can I find out what the requirements are?

Most states have exceptions for people in training. If you stay where you are, or apply for a new state license after residency, they may ask you for proof of CME. Generally, all it takes for the exception is a two line letter from your PD stating you were in residency during period x-y.
